1. What is Predion 5 DT?


Predion 5 DT is a pain reliever, antipyretic, anti-inflammatory drug manufactured by Apimed Pharmaceutical Joint Stock Company - Vietnam.
The drug contains the ingredient Prednisolone (in the form of Prednisolone sodium phosphate) 5mg, which is prepared in the form of dispersible tablets and is packaged in a box of 3 blisters, 10 blisters x 10 tablets or bottles of 100 tablets, 200 tablets and 500 tablets.

2. Uses of Predion 5 DT


Predion 5 DT is a corticosteroid, indicated in adults and children for the treatment of certain diseases or for the following anti-inflammatory effects:
Bronchial asthma, ulcerative colitis, severe hypersensitivity reactions , anaphylaxis, systemic lupus erythematosus, rheumatoid arthritis, dermatomyositis, mixed connective tissue disease (except systemic scleroderma), temporal arteritis, periarteritis nodular. Dermatitis includes bullous pemphigus, common pemphigus, and pyoderma necrosis. Nephrotic syndrome and acute interstitial nephritis , Crohn's disease, sarcoidosis. Rheumatic heart disease, hemolytic anemia, acute and chronic leukemia, multiple myeloma, malignant lymphoma, idiopathic thrombocytopenic purpura. Immunosuppression in surgery.

3. Contraindications to drug use


Predion 5 DT is not allowed in some of the following cases:
In most cases of infection, the drug is not allowed. Some viral diseases are progressing such as: Hepatitis, herpes, shingles, varlcelle. Some neurological disorders have not been treated. Live vaccines. Allergy to Prednisolone or other ingredients of the drug.

6. Predion side effects


When using the drug Predion 5 DT may cause unwanted side effects or discomfort.
The most common discomforts when taking the drug can be:
Weight gain, round face and redness. Some bruises appear. Arterial hypertension. Sleep disorders. Osteoporosis, broken bones. Changes in biological parameters (salt, sugar, potassium) may require an additional diet or treatment. More rare effects include:
Decreased adrenal secretion. Growth disorders in children. Menstrual disorders. There have been few cases of tendon rupture, especially when used with fluoroquinolones. Muscle weakness. Digestive tract disorders. Skin disorders. Some forms of glaucoma or cataracts. All side effects or discomforts not mentioned in the prescription should be reported to the doctor. 8. Notes when using Predion


8.1. Before treatment Inform your treating physician if you have peptic ulcer disease, colon disease, recent bowel surgery, recent vaccination, diabetes mellitus, arterial hypertension , infection (especially a history of tuberculosis), kidney failure, liver failure, osteoporosis, and myasthenia gravis (myopathy with muscle fatigue). Avoid using this drug in combination with a sultopride (a drug that acts on the central nervous system) or with a live vaccine that has reduced motivation. 8.2. During and after treatment Avoid contact with people who have measles or chickenpox. In the case of long-term treatment, the drug should not be stopped suddenly, but only as directed by the doctor. During treatment and within one year after treatment, the doctor must be informed about the use of corticosteroids during surgical intervention or under stress (fever, illness). Oral or injectable corticosteroids may increase the risk of liver disease and tendon rupture (exception). 8.3. Precautions while taking your medicine During treatment, your doctor will likely recommend that you follow a diet, especially low in salt. For pregnant women, use only in cases of necessity. If you find out that you are pregnant during treatment, you should consult your doctor for the best indication. Avoid breast-feeding during treatment because the drug passes into breast milk. 8.4.
